ISTI's Technology Base
ISTI has extensive experience working with software technologies
such as Java, C/C++, Python, CORBA, Perl, Tcl/Tk, and RDBMS (Oracle,
Sybase, MS Access, MySQL, PostgreSQL). We work with most operating
systems in use today, including UNIX (Solaris, SunOS, Linux, BSD), PalmOS, Win9X,
WinNT, Win2K, WinXP, and Mac OS X. We are group of dedicated software
developers that specialize in Java, Python, Databases, UNIX, Linux, and
Instrumentation (not mutually exclusive). We look forward to working
with you to solve your problems. Our goal is to use the right technology to solve a customer's problems, not necessarily the bleeding edge that some companies might try to force on you.
The two founders' resumes are provided here as an example of the capabilities of some of our staff:
Here are some of Our Core Technologies
- Java - Servlets, Applets, and Applications
- C/C++
- CORBA Clients & Servers
- Scripting - Python, Perl, Tcl/Tk, Ruby, PHP, JavaScript, UNIX shells, Visual Basic
- PKI - OpenSSL, Luna Cryptographic Tokens, PKCS#11
- PalmOS - PDA's
- Windows Mobile devices
- Open Web-Enabled Interfaces - HTML/Apache/mod_python/PHP/mod_perl/DBI/Tomcat/JSP/JSDK/J2EE/ruby/web2py
- RDBMS (Sybase, Oracle, Access, MS SQL Server, PostgreSQL, MySQL, PearDB, DBI/DBD, JDBC, ODBC)
- TCP/IP implementations (sendmail, named, SAMBA, Firewalls, HTTP/HTTPS, NFS, DNS, FTP, Secure Shell, SSL)
- Unix (Solaris, SunOS, Linux, BSDI, FreeBSD, Mac OS X)
- Linux (RedHat, Mandrake, SuSE, Debian, Slackware, TurboLinux, we've used them all!)
- Windows (95, 98, NT, 2000, XP, blah blah blah, you get the picture....)
Project Experience
- Software Architecture and Design Services
- Custom graphical user interfaces
- End-to-end system integration
- Client/server architectured solutions
- N-tier distributed solutions
- Software control of hardware
- Remote data acquistion
- Instrument and Process Control
- Custom database design and implementation
- Web interfaces